Plattenschau #14 - Thrill On The Hill
LP (1982) Devaki Records
In 1982 Dunn & Bruce Street appeared with their only album called Official Business to 'give the gift of music' which brought us some big tunes like Shout for Joy, Yearnin' & Burnin' or Mt. You (Up On The Hill).

Plattenschau #13 - Dutch Boogie
12" (1986) Stamina Records
Mahogany was a dutch one-hit female group that managed to release this big boogie bomb in 1986 on Stamina Records. The relatively tough to find 12" includes everything that makes a Boogie-addict's heart go boom. Fat bassline, long upbuilding intro, fresh vocoders, nice vocals and the instrumental on the flip-side. Check the vinyl-rip.

Plattenschau #9 - Lock Up The Wife And Daughter!
LP (1982) Virgin Records
First we just wanted to share a rare video from Gangster-Funker No.1 Prince Charles - this is what came out:
"Prince Charles is a third generation funkster from Boston...young (22), black (very), and right off the streets (Roxbury), his aggressive stance and dark shades make them (the rulers of America) want to lock up the wife and daughter. If the image wasn't enough there is the music: contemporary funk that draws upon the greasy grit of George Clinton and 1980's synthesizer sleaze."
"Side one, cut in Boston, is slowed down, sultry, mean music dealing with the true life stereotypes of so many streetcorners. You 'Don't fake the funk' if you want 'Cash Money' and 'Big Chested Girls' go for men who are 'Cold as Ice'. This fixation with image, flesh and dollars is documented by Prince Charles using fatback drums and scratchy guitars. It is pure, hard, late-1970's funk in the tradition of P-Funk, the Bar-Kays, and Cameo."

"Side two reflects the shift by Prince Charles and producer Tony Rose to New York, where the synthesizer reigns supreme. 'Fool for Love', the instrumental 'Jungle Stomp', 'Bush Beat', and 'Video Freak' all have the surrealism of computer music, yet still maintain street heat through the use of Latin percussion. In fact even the synthesizer, once regarded as aural toys, breaths with polyrhythmic fire under the guidance of Charles and Rose. Spacey, yet fiery. Rhythmic, yet luminous like a video game."

"Together, side one and two are a little history of Black dance in the post-disco era. But historical stuff aside, this is good dance music. Perfect for your local club, livingroom, or (yes) your favorite walkman."
...and also in heavy rotation at every Das Zündet Party! The text is taken from the original liner notes by Nelson George.

Plattenschau #4 - Cosmic Chronic
12' (2013) People Potential Unlimited
Hailing from Miami, Cosmic Chronic is probably the illest Modern Funk Posse on this planet!
No matter under which projects they release their "Lo-Fi-Boogie" beasts,
it's always an electrifying pleasure.
Psychic Mirrors third release is called Charlene. Horny vocals, deep bassrides and a phenomenal flip side.
I'm pretty sure we'll get back to them in recent future since every release is worth a post.So get your wax for maximum funktivity!
